
Dome Lamps
The dome lamps will come on when you open a door
and the dome override button is in the out position.
You can also turn the dome lamps on by turning the
instrument panel brightness thumbwheel, located next
to the exterior lamps control, all the way up. In this
position, the dome lamps will remain on whether
the doors are opened or closed.
Dome Lamp Override
E
(Dome Lamp Override): You can use the dome
override button, located below the exterior lamps control,
to set the dome lamps to come on automatically when
the doors are opened, or to remain off. To turn the lamps
off, press the button to the in position. With the button
in this position, the dome lamps will remain off when the
doors are open. To return the lamps to automatic
operation, press the button again and return the button
to the out position. With the button in this position,
the dome lamps will come on when you open a door.
Entry Lighting
Your vehicle is equipped with an illuminated entry
feature.
When a door is opened, the dome lamps and puddle
lamps will come on if the dome override button is in the
out position. If the dome override button is pressed
in, the lamps will not come on.
Exit Lighting
With exit lighting, the interior lamps will come on when
you remove the key from the ignition. The lamps will
not come on if the dome override button is pressed in.
Front Reading Lamps
Your vehicle has front reading lamps located in the
overhead console. Press the round button located next
to the lamp to turn the lamp on. The lamps can be
adjusted to point in the direction you want them to go.
Press the button again to turn the lamp off.
